Have you heard of the Designer Bookbinders society in England? Along with the Society of Bookbinders and the Guild of Book Workers it is one of the foremost groups devoted to the craft of fine bookbinding. Designer Bookbinders began over fifty years ago and runs regular exhibitions and competitions. They are dedicated to the encouraging the highest standards in bookbinding. Its membership includes some incredibly talented and highly regarded makers in the fields of fine bookbinding, book arts and artists’ books, each with a passion for presenting the bound text as a unique art object, encompassing text, structure, illustration, print and paper.
